5 Kepwell Bank Top

    5, KEPWELL BANK TOP, PRUDHOE, PRUDHOE, NE42 5PW

    This detached freehold property on Kepwell Bank Top last sold in March 2005 for £226,000. Based on price growth in the NE42 district since then, its estimated current value is £360,894 — placing it in the 61st percentile nationally and the 87th percentile within NE42. The property covers 127 m² (1,367 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£2,842 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of B.
